func (h *Handler) redirectToConsent(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request, authorizeRequest fosite.AuthorizeRequester) error {
schema := "https"
if h.ForcedHTTP {
schema = "http"
}

// Error can be ignored because a session will always be returned
cookie, _ := h.CookieStore.Get(r, consentCookieName)

challenge, err := h.Consent.IssueChallenge(authorizeRequest, schema+"://"+r.Host+r.URL.String(), cookie)
host, _, err := net.SplitHostPort(r.Host)
if err != nil {
host = r.Host
}

authUrl, err := url.Parse(h.Issuer + AuthPath)
if err != nil {
return err
}
authHost, _, err := net.SplitHostPort(authUrl.Host)
if err != nil {
authHost = authUrl.Host
}
if authHost != host {
h.L.WithFields(logrus.Fields{
"request_host": host,
"issuer_host": authHost,
}).Warnln("Host from auth request does not match issuer host. The consent return redirect may fail.")
}
authUrl.RawQuery = r.URL.RawQuery

challenge, err := h.Consent.IssueChallenge(authorizeRequest, authUrl.String(), cookie)
if err != nil {
return err
}

type FakeConsentStrategy struct {
RedirectURL string
}

func (s *FakeConsentStrategy) ValidateResponse(authorizeRequest fosite.AuthorizeRequester, token string, session *sessions.Session) (claims *Session, err error) {
return nil, nil
}

func (s *FakeConsentStrategy) IssueChallenge(authorizeRequest fosite.AuthorizeRequester, redirectURL string, session *sessions.Session) (token string, err error) {
s.RedirectURL = redirectURL
return "token", nil
}

func TestIssuerRedirect(t *testing.T) {
storage := storage.NewExampleStore()
secret := []byte("my super secret password")
config := compose.Config{}
privateKey, _ := rsa.GenerateKey(rand.Reader, 2048)

consentUrl, _ := url.Parse("http://consent.localhost")

cs := &FakeConsentStrategy{}

h := &Handler{
H: herodot.NewJSONWriter(nil),
Issuer: "http://127.0.0.1/some/proxied/path",
OAuth2: compose.ComposeAllEnabled(&config, storage, secret, privateKey),
ConsentURL: *consentUrl,
CookieStore: sessions.NewCookieStore([]byte("my super secret password")),
Consent: cs,
L: logrus.New(),
}

r := httprouter.New()
h.SetRoutes(r)
ts := httptest.NewServer(r)

authUrl, _ := url.Parse(ts.URL)
v := url.Values{}
v.Set("response_type", "code")
v.Set("client_id", "my-client")
v.Set("redirect_uri", "http://localhost:3846/callback")
v.Set("scope", "openid")
v.Set("state", "my super secret state")
authUrl.Path = "/oauth2/auth"
authUrl.RawQuery = v.Encode()

client := &http.Client{
CheckRedirect: func(req *http.Request, via []*http.Request) error {
return http.ErrUseLastResponse
},
}

res, _ := client.Get(authUrl.String())

authRedirect, _ := url.Parse(cs.RedirectURL)
assert.Equal(t, "/some/proxied/path/oauth2/auth", authRedirect.Path, "The redirect URL sent in the challenge includes the full issuer path")
assert.Equal(t, authUrl.Query(), authRedirect.Query(), "The auth redirect should have the same parameters with the addition of challenge")

defer res.Body.Close()
}
